Health reform strategy will be presented in Ukraine soon
The Ukrainian government in the near future will present the health reform strategy, which provides for the transition to the system of financing health services, Prime Minister of Ukraine Volodymyr Groysman has said.
"Changing the system of funding the health care sector, transferring to financing health services in the future, involving health insurance in this sector, recognizing all treatment protocols that exist in the country, introducing state standards – this way we can form a new health care system in Ukraine," Groysman said at a working breakfast with representatives of business circles in New York.
Groysman noted the government had decided on deregulation of the pharmaceutical market in Ukraine. In particular, it simplified registration of medicines produced and consumed in the United States, Canada, the European Union, Australia and Japan.
According to him, up to now about five or six companies "have controlled the market with non-market methods" in Ukraine and prevented imports of drugs from abroad.
